# MicroSpeech demo.
|
|
#
|
|
# Download the pre-trained Yes/No model from here:
|
|
# https://raw.githubusercontent.com/iabdalkader/microspeech-yesno-model/main/model.tflite
|
|
# Save the model to storage, reset and run the example.
|
|
import audio
|
|
import time
|
|
import tf
|
|
import micro_speech
|
|
import pyb
|
|
|
|
labels = ["Silence", "Unknown", "Yes", "No"]
|
|
|
|
led_red = pyb.LED(1)
|
|
led_green = pyb.LED(2)
|
|
|
|
model = tf.load("/model.tflite")
|
|
speech = micro_speech.MicroSpeech()
|
|
audio.init(channels=1, frequency=16000, gain=24, highpass=0.9883)
|
|
|
|
# Start audio streaming
|
|
audio.start_streaming(speech.audio_callback)
|
|
|
|
while True:
|
|
# Run micro-speech without a timeout and filter detections by label index.
|
|
idx = speech.listen(model, timeout=0, threshold=0.78, filter=[2, 3])
|
|
led = led_green if idx == 2 else led_red
|
|
print(labels[idx])
|
|
for i in range(0, 4):
|
|
led.on()
|
|
time.sleep_ms(25)
|
|
led.off()
|
|
time.sleep_ms(25)
|
|
|
|
# Stop streaming
|
|
audio.stop_streaming()
